Responsibilities

Program Strategy & Execution

  • Lead end-to-end technical product and service launches across Support, Customer Success, and customer-facing organizations, ensuring alignment to business objectives, timelines, and success metrics.
  • Drive cross-functional programs from initiation through delivery, managing priorities, dependencies, and execution plans.

Cross-Functional Leadership

  • Partner with Engineering, Data Science, Product Management, and business stakeholders to define program scope, requirements, deliverables, and outcomes.
  • Facilitate alignment across teams to resolve issues, drive decisions, and achieve business goals.

Technical Program Leadership

  • Serve as a subject matter expert for Cloud and AI platform technologies, including Azure Compute, Storage, Networking, Fabric, and AI workloads.
  • Translate complex technical concepts into actionable plans that improve customer readiness, operational effectiveness, and business outcomes.

Stakeholder Management & Communication

  • Build trusted relationships with stakeholders and provide regular updates on milestones, risks, issues, and program status.
  • Influence decisions through data-driven insights, recommendations, and business impact analysis.

Risk Management & Operational Excellence

  • Identify risks, dependencies, and operational challenges; develop mitigation strategies and escalation plans to ensure successful program outcomes.
  • Drive continuous improvement through process optimization, governance, readiness planning, and operational best practices.

Business Insights & Innovation

  • Leverage data, customer feedback, and performance metrics to inform decisions and improve service delivery.
  • Stay current on emerging technologies, including AI, large language models (LLMs), semantic indexing, and Microsoft platform innovations to enhance program effectiveness.

Technical Program Management IC4 - The typical base pay range for this role across the U.S. is USD $119,800 - $234,700 per year. There is a different range applicable to specific work locations, within the San Francisco Bay area and New York City metropolitan area, and the base pay range for this role in those locations is USD $160,200 - $261,000 per year.

Microsoft is a global technology leader that empowers individuals and organizations to achieve more through innovative software, services, and devices. Founded in 1975, the company is best known for its flagship products like the Windows operating system and Microsoft Office suite. In addition to personal computing, Microsoft is a leader in cloud computing with its Azure platform, providing a range of solutions for businesses to enhance productivity and efficiency. With a strong commitment to sustainability and accessibility, Microsoft continues to drive technological advancements that shape the future of work and learning.
